I've an array file, class double 5000x1, saved in Matlab drive. it contains a column of time series data:
what is the correct format to be used for neural network analyses? tks

When using neural networks for time series analysis in MATLAB, especially with the Deep Learning Toolbox, it's important to format your data appropriately to ensure effective training and prediction. Here's a guideline on the correct data format:
  • For the input data, your 5000x1 array should be structured into sequences if you are using networks like LSTMs or RNNs. Each sequence serves as an input sample.
  • The data should be in a format compatible with MATLAB's neural network functions. For LSTM networks, this often means using cell arrays where each cell contains a sequence of data points.
  • Normalize your data to improve network performance. This involves scaling your data to a specific range, often [0, 1].
